(a)A director may resign at any time by notice to the Chair of the Authority. In cases of municipal directors, notice shall also be given to the legislative body of the municipality represented.
(b)The Board may declare, by written certification to the legislative body of a member, a vacancy for the position of the director from that member after the director has failed to attend three unexcused, consecutive meetings of the Board within one year beginning in March and ending in February of the subsequent year.
